Humana's 1st-quarter earnings at a Glance

Health insurer Humana posts 19 percent gain in Medicare Advantage membership

Health insurer Humana Inc., one of the biggest players in the Medicare Advantage business, posted a 26 percent increase in first-quarter profit Monday.

Here's a breakdown of how the Louisville, Ky., company fared in its key segments.

Pretax income:

Government segment, $279.2 million, compared to $166.1 million a year ago.

Commercial segment, $137.8 million, compared to $127.7 million a year ago.

Enrollment:

Medicare Advantage, 1.74 million, up 19 percent from a year ago.

Stand-alone Medicare prescription drug plans, 1.9 million, compared to nearly 2.1 million a year ago.

Premiums and administrative service fees:

Medicare Advantage, $4.82 billion, up 19 percent from a year ago.

Commercial segment, $1.85 billion, down 2 percent from a year ago.

Premiums:

Stand-alone Medicare prescription drug plans, $579 million, down 3 percent from a year ago.
